logo

Hur fungerar en dator

När en person nyligen introduceras till ett datorsystem, utvecklas en nyfikenhet i sinnet att hur den här maskinen faktiskt fungerar, hur den förstår mina ord och sätter resultat så fort mitt öga blinkar. Alla sådana frågor uppstår när vi inte har kunskap om datorbakgrunden. Här kommer vi att ge dig alla svar på ditt nyfikna sinne och diskutera datorsystemets arbetsprocess.

Vad är en dator

Till en början, som ny användare, bör man introduceras med maskinen, som är känd som Dator . Så en dator är en elektronisk enhet som kräver en strömförsörjning för att fungera. Strömförsörjning är livslinan för en dator eftersom vatten är livlinan för en människokropp. En datormaskin används för att behandla den information som vi tillhandahåller. Den tar information eller data från ena änden, lagrar den för att bearbeta och slutligen, efter att bearbetningen är klar, matar den ut resultatet å andra sidan. Informationen den tar i ena änden kallas Datoringång , och resultatet som det ger efter bearbetning kallas Datorutgång . Platsen där den lagrar informationen kallas Datorminne eller RAM (Random Access Memory) . Ett datorsystem lagrar information i bitar . Bits är den minsta lagringsenheten i en dator.

Huvudkomponenter i en dator

Ett datorsystem fungerar genom att kombinera inmatning, lagringsutrymme, bearbetning och utdata. Dessa fyra är huvudkomponenterna i en dator.

Låt oss förstå en efter en:

    Inmatning:En ingång är den information som vi tillhandahåller till datorn. Vi tillhandahåller informationen med hjälp av datorns inmatningsenheter: tangentbord, mus, mikrofon och många fler. Till exempel, när vi skriver något med hjälp av ett tangentbord, är det känt som en indata som tillhandahålls till datorn.Lagringsutrymme:Det är platsen där vår input lagras. Det är känt som datorminne som håller data i det. En dator använder en hårddisk för att lagra filer och dokument. Den använder två typer av minne, det vill säga internminne och externt minne. Internminnet är känt som RAM, vilket är flyktigt till sin natur. Den lagrar data temporärt, d.v.s. när data är redo att bearbetas, laddas in i RAM och efter bearbetning flyttar den data till lagringen. Å andra sidan används externt minne för att lagra data permanent tills du tar bort det eller det kraschade.Bearbetning:Bearbetningen av inmatningen utförs av CPU:n, som är datorns centrala bearbetningsenhet. Det är också känt som hjärnan på en dator som är ansvarig för att bearbeta de data som användaren tillhandahåller. Datorhjärnans hastighet är fyra gånger snabbare än den mänskliga hjärnans hastighet.Produktion:När vi skriver något med ett tangentbord, är platsen där vi ser den inskrivna inmatningen datorskärmen eller datorskärmen. En datorskärm gör det möjligt att se indata som vi gav till datorn. Inklusive detta finns det olika typer av utgångsenheter på en dator, såsom högtalare, projektorer, skrivare och många fler.

Dessa spelar alla en viktig roll i hur ett datorsystem fungerar.

Hårdvara och mjukvara

Ingångs- och utgångsenheterna som kan vidröras fysiskt kallas systemets hårdvara. Såsom tangentbord, mus, skärm, etc. De applikationer som finns i datorn och bara kan se dem men inte kan röra dem kallas programvara . Såsom Microsoft Word , Excel , Paint och all installerad programvara på systemet.

Hur får allt en dator att fungera

Dessa huvudkomponenter i ett datorsystem tillsammans gör att en dator kan fungera.

  • Operativ system.
  • Systemets startprocess börjar som laddar operativsystemet (Windows, Linux, Mac, etc.) med alla tillhörande filer. Bootstrap loader startar uppstarten av systemet. Så på detta sätt laddas Windows och dess andra viktiga tjänster till systemet.
  • När operativsystemet har laddats till datorn, blir den installerade hårdvaran i systemen aktiv och kan kommunicera med CPU:n. Kommunikationen mellan hårdvaruenheterna sker via en avbrottsbegäran (IRQ). När den aktuella uppgiften redan körs, skickar avbrottskontrollern begäran till CPU:n att sluta bearbeta en ny hårdvaruförfrågan tills exekveringen av den aktuella uppgiften är klar. CPU:n håller den nya begäran på is, och den processen lagras som en minnesadress i minnesstacken. När den aktuella uppgiftskörningen är klar, återupptas och bearbetas den parkerade uppgiften.
    Men om datorn misslyckas i POST-testet påträffas en oregelbunden POST. Vi kan förstå den oregelbundna POST när vi hör ett pip från systemet som meddelar oss att något problem har uppstått.
  • När vi slår på datorsystemet genom att trycka på strömknappen når en signal till nätaggregatet som omvandlar växelströmmen till likström, även känd som DC. Därefter tillförs en ordentlig ström till varje komponent i datorn.
  • Utan problem kommer alla komponenter i sitt aktiva tillstånd, strömförsörjningen skickar en signal till moderkortet och CPU:n via transistorer. Under tiden tar processorn bort överbliven data i minnet och CPU:n blir redo att ta över instruktionen (inmatningen) och bearbeta den.
  • A POST (power-on self-test) utförs på datorn i en sekvens för att säkerställa att de viktigaste datorkomponenterna finns och fungerar korrekt. När datorn klarar testet, för det första, vaknar 64-byte-minnet eftersom det bär systeminformation om tid och datum och all annan hårdvarurelaterad information som är installerad på systemet. Denna information börjar laddas och POST kontrollerar och jämför denna information med systeminställningarna. Om den jämförs framgångsrikt, laddar den de grundläggande drivrutinerna (som tillåter kommunikation av hårdvaruenheter med CPU och dator att fortsätta att starta) och avbryter hanterare för den installerade hårdvaran som tangentbord, hårddisk, mus och många fler.
  • Efter det kontrollerar POST bildskärmsadaptern, och utan att några problem hittas laddar den skärmen som vi ser på datorskärmen. Därefter kontrolleras att om Kallstart eller omstart (varmstart) utförs genom att titta på minnesadressen 0000:0472. Om det är 1234h betyder det att det är en omstart och resten av POST-stegen hoppas över. Men om det inte är så betyder det att det är en kall start och de återstående POST-stegen fortsätter.
  • Nu kontrolleras RAM-minnet som är installerat på datorsystemet.

Till sist testar POST den optiska enheten och hårddisken på datorn genom att skicka signaler till dem. När alla enheter klarar testet är POST klar och instruerar att påbörja laddningen av